The Future of Humanity Institute is pleased to announce the Amlin-Oxford Martin School Conference on Systemic Risk, taking place on February 11th-12th.  Speakers will include Lord Robert May, Professor Didier Sornette, Professor Ian Goldin, and Professor Doyne Farmer.

Topics will cover a wide variety of phenomena, such as how to predict full scale system collapse.  Dr. Milica Vasiljevic and Dr. Mario Weick will discuss how cognitive biases can impact the way we model extreme events, while Dr. Gordon Woo will give us insights into catastrophe modelling.
